Transaction 861da992c263214485d7be69209705eefafe064654cf2c9e9dd6aba46b3827f8
1 Input
1 Output
-
861da992c263214485d7be69209705eefafe064654cf2c9e9dd6aba46b3827f8:0
- value
- 2514120
- script pubkey
- OP_0 OP_PUSHBYTES_20 de61deceb1cf406b30eff99949880488cf4ecce5
- address
- bc1qmesaan43eaqxkv80lxv5nzqy3r85an895nhsk6